Pakistan expresses concern over Egypt violence
ISLAMABAD: Pakistan expressed its dismay and deep concern over the use of force by Egyptian security forces against unarmed civilians resulting in the loss of innocent lives.

A Foreign Office press release described the tragic events of 14 August as a “major setback for Egypt’s return to democracy.”

The press release added that as a friend and a well- wisher of the people of Egypt, Pakistan is closely observing developments in that country and urges all parties to exercise restraint and to respect the fundamental rights of the fraternal people of that great country. The political prisoners must be released to ensure that the legal and constitutional issues can be addressed through dialogue among all parties, in an inclusive and peaceful manner, to enable the country to successfully restore the democratic institutions, as early as possible.

It is the earnest hope of the Government and people of Pakistan that the brotherly people of Egypt with their patience, tolerance and fortitude, would be able to overcome their current challenges, in a manner that ensures sustained democracy, political stability, and economic development, while ensuring peace and well-being of the people.
